Examining Past Customer Testimonials


Digging into previous consumer endorsements can give you indispensable understanding into a specialist's workmanship and professionalism. They act as a real-time efficiency evaluation of the service provider's service top quality.


Here's exactly how you can take advantage of them:




  • Customer comments: It's the most genuine resource of info concerning the service provider. Search for patterns in the responses. Are there duplicated complaints or commends concerning a particular facet of their service? This can offer you a clearer photo of their toughness and weaknesses.




  • Credibility check: Testimonials can help you assess the track record of the specialist on the market. Adverse evaluations aren't always a red flag, as long as they're few and the contractor has taken actions to resolve them.




  • Reliability assessment: Testimonials can aid analyze the trustworthiness of the professional. Look for responses on their honesty, integrity, and openness.

Frequently Asked Questions


What Is the Estimated Timeline for the Completion of the Roofing Project?


You'll need to take into account project administration, labor force schedule, climate factors to consider, material delivery, and permit purchase. Typically, a roof job takes a couple of days to a week, however it can differ.


Uncertain climate can delay work, as can awaiting products or authorizations. Also, the size of the workforce can impact the timeline.


It's ideal to review all these variables with your service provider to get a realistic price quote.

What Kind of Warranty or Guarantee Does the Contractor Offer on Their Work and Materials Used?


Did you recognize that 75% of house owners overlook guarantee information? Don't be just one of them.


Ask your professional concerning warranty duration and assure specifics. Verify both handiwork and materials are covered, as this impacts long-term roofing sturdiness.


Additionally, inquire about warranty transferability; it's a reward if you plan to sell your home in the future.


It's critical to understand these aspects prior to signing any agreement. Remember, a reputable specialist will not avoid these conversations.
